How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Big Lake?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Big Lake Studio Apartments | $750 | $750 | $750 |
| Big Lake 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,053 | $700 | $1,611 |
| Big Lake 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,213 | $735 | $2,191 |
| Big Lake 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,589 | $609 | $3,138 |
| Big Lake 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,135 | $555 | $1,720 |
